Adjustable Mounting Systems

Your solar panel mounting system plays a key role in the efficiency of your solar operations. For example, adjustable solar mounting components allow your panels to move in accordance with the sun's path, ensuring maximum exposure.

On top of this, sun-tracking technology will ensure that your solar farm never misses a ray from the sun. The more flexible your system, the better.

Enhanced Durability

The stronger your panels, the longer they will last. We know solar panel replacement and repair can be expensive. That's why we recommend investing in mounting systems and panels with high durability.

Reinforced materials and advanced engineering will keep your solar panels working for longer. Meanwhile, adding weather-resistant materials will keep your solar panel performance high, no matter the weather.

Maintenance-Friendly Panels

No matter how robust your installation is, you will require maintenance from time to time. To get more from your maintenance spend, prioritizing maintenance-friendly design today is essential.

For example, quick-release mechanisms or accessible components make it much easier for technicians to get the job done. This will reduce your downtime and ensure that your whole system stays operational for longer.

Modular Design

If your solar installation is working well for you, you might wish to expand. Upgrading to modular mounting systems allows you to do this easily and more cost-effectively.

Scalable and modular design allows for the addition of more panels without the need for significant structural adjustments. This flexibility is crucial for adapting to changing energy demands and expanding solar projects over time.

Smarter Land Usage

For large-scale solar installations, space is the most precious resource. The more you have, the more power you generate. However, most of us can't just magic more land out of thin air. Although we do have a say in how our land is used.

For example, if you're a farmowner, you could opt for a so-called "dual-usage" installation. This combines the land for your solar farm with your agricultural land, with minimal disruption to either. Such approaches allow you to benefit from solar without compromising on the potential of your land.
